## Ticket: Expired credentials — rate-parity checker

The Fernwick rate-parity checker stopped polling partner rate feeds on Monday; all requests to the Harborline aggregation service now return authorization failures. Root cause is the ninety-day credential expiry we flagged last quarter but never automated. Rotation is done manually for now, and a follow-up task exists to wire it into the vault rotator. For this week's fix, the Harborline team has issued a replacement, recorded below.

gateway credential: kto23_LX9A4ys6i4nzHtpOLNLodKK

## Changelog — Forgewick CI 4.2.1

Changed defaults: build agents now sync against the Forgewick coordinator's clock instead of trusting local NTP. We saw artifact timestamps drift up to 40 seconds between the Delvane and Ostrel agent pools, which broke cache invalidation and reproducible-build checks. Max tolerated skew dropped from 30s to 5s; agents exceeding it are quarantined until resync. The new defaults applied to all pools are as follows.

config for tagep-yajef:
ulawyn:
  log_level: error
  metrics_host: metrics.ulawyn.lumiclabs.internal
  pin: 0564
  pool_size: 32

Runbook: Thumbnail generation queue (Pinwheel pipeline). If thumbnails stall, first check the Pinwheel worker pool depth; anything above 10,000 pending jobs means a resize worker crash loop. Drain the dead-letter queue only after confirming source images exist in the Saltmere store. To query queue metrics and requeue jobs, authenticate against the Pinwheel admin endpoint with the key below.

service key, yadug-bajog: zpat3_pou

**Vendor note: Inkmill markdown pipeline**

Rendering for Parchway docs is outsourced to Inkmill under an annual contract, renewing each March. They handle sanitization and PDF export; we own the upload queue. SLA: 4-hour response on rendering failures. Escalate only after two failed retries. Their support desk is reachable at the address below.

billing contact of hahaf-baguf = zorael.tammir.jorius@sivrelhq.internal